Beginning Ballet and the accompanying web resource introduces students to the study of ballet as a perfroming art and provides instructional support in learning the foundational ballet technique. The book features more than 80 photographs and concise descriptions covering basic foot and arm postitions, barre exercises and centre combinations. Beginning Ballet introduces students to the structure of a ballet class, including expectations, etiquette and attire. Students also learn how to prepare for class, maintain proper nutrition and hydration and avoid injury. In addition the accompanying web resource present more than 70 instructional video clips and 50 photographs and also includes an interactive quiz, audio clips of ballet terms with pronunciation in French and assignments. Beginning Ballet is a part of Human Kinestics Interactive Dance Series. The series includes resources for modern dance, ballet and tap dance that support introductory dance technique courses taught through dance, physical education and fine arts departments.
